Quarterly Planning Note — Board Review

The launch of Solstice Ledger remains scheduled for Q3, contingent on certification of the payments module by late May. Tooling, packaging, and the partner enablement program are on track; marketing spend is phased across eight weeks with a reserve held for the Averton trade fair. Risks center on supplier lead times and a competing release from Norwick Systems. The confidential element of the launch plan follows below.

board note of kafog-bajep: Briathek Partners is in early talks to buy Aldaelek Group for about $47.1 million. The Ulaath launch date is September 4, and nothing goes to the press before then.

Step 4: Flip over the tax-rate lookup cache in Parcelmint. Once the old lookup table is drained, the new cache takes over automatically — support folks will just see faster rate queries. If a merchant reports stale rates, tell them to wait one refresh cycle. The refresh cadence comes from these settings.

config for kagup-hahig:
druwyn:
  pin: 2801
  metrics_host: metrics.druwyn.zemvarlabs.internal
  tenant: sorius
  seal: seal_798a43d7

Subject: DR drill recap — Quashbot survived, mostly

Hey future maintainers — quick note from yesterday's disaster-recovery drill at Thornapple. We nuked the primary region and Quashbot, our alert deduplicator, came back in about nine minutes. Dedup state was stale, so expect a brief page storm on failover; that's known. If you ever need to restore its encrypted state snapshot, the recovery passphrase is below.

unlock words, tawif-tahop: oliys-ulawyn-tamdor-lamys-casox-jormir-fraius-kasath-ulador-ulamir-holir-sorys-holeth

NEW STARTER CHECKLIST — Night Shift Item 4

Show the starter the Larkspur Interview Suite on level 2. Confirm they know recordings stay inside the room, blinds must be drawn during sessions, and the door auto-locks after 30 seconds. Before leaving them, make sure they have noted the suite's entry code below.

turnstile pass: bdg-NG-3